
In the realm of computing and printing, spooling stands as a pivotal process that ensures the smooth and efficient handling of print jobs. But what exactly is spooling, and how does it intertwine with the seemingly unrelated concept of the color of your dreams? Let’s delve into the intricacies of spooling, its implications, and its metaphorical connection to our subconscious.
Understanding Spooling in Printing
Spooling, an acronym for Simultaneous Peripheral Operations On-line, is a process used in computing to manage data sent to a peripheral device, such as a printer, at a rate that the device can handle. When you send a document to print, the data is first stored in a buffer or a spool, which acts as a temporary holding area. This allows the computer to continue with other tasks while the printer processes the print job at its own pace.
The Mechanics of Spooling
- Data Buffering: When a print job is initiated, the data is sent to a spooler, which stores it in a buffer. This buffer can be a portion of the computer’s memory or a dedicated spooling file on the disk.
- Queue Management: The spooler manages a queue of print jobs, ensuring that each job is processed in the order it was received. This prevents conflicts and ensures that the printer is not overwhelmed.
- Device Communication: The spooler communicates with the printer, sending data in manageable chunks that the printer can process without interruption.
- Error Handling: If an error occurs during printing, the spooler can pause the job, allowing the user to resolve the issue before resuming.
Benefits of Spooling
- Efficiency: Spooling allows the computer to continue processing other tasks while the printer handles the print job, improving overall system efficiency.
- Resource Management: By managing the flow of data to the printer, spooling prevents the printer from becoming a bottleneck.
- User Convenience: Users can send multiple print jobs to the spooler without waiting for each job to complete, enhancing productivity.
The Metaphorical Connection: Spooling and the Color of Your Dreams
Now, let’s explore the metaphorical connection between spooling and the color of your dreams. Dreams, like print jobs, are complex and multifaceted. They are composed of various elements—emotions, memories, and subconscious thoughts—that need to be processed and organized.
The Spooling of Dreams
- Data Buffering in Dreams: Just as a spooler buffers print data, our minds buffer the myriad of thoughts and experiences that form the basis of our dreams. This buffering allows our subconscious to process and organize these elements into coherent dream narratives.
- Queue Management in the Subconscious: The subconscious mind manages a queue of dream elements, ensuring that each is processed in a way that makes sense within the dream’s context. This prevents the dream from becoming chaotic or overwhelming.
- Communication Between Conscious and Subconscious: The spooler-like function of the subconscious communicates with the conscious mind, presenting dreams in a way that can be understood and interpreted upon waking.
- Error Handling in Dreams: Just as a spooler can pause a print job in case of an error, the subconscious can alter or pause a dream if it encounters conflicting or distressing elements, allowing the dreamer to process these issues in a safer context.
The Color of Your Dreams
The color of your dreams can be seen as a metaphor for the emotional and psychological tone of your subconscious processing. Just as different colors evoke different emotions, the “color” of your dreams reflects the underlying feelings and themes that your subconscious is working through.
- Vivid Colors: Dreams with vivid, bright colors may indicate a strong emotional response or a heightened state of awareness.
- Muted Colors: Dreams with muted or dull colors might suggest a more subdued emotional state or a need for introspection.
- Monochromatic Dreams: Dreams in black and white could symbolize a focus on clarity, simplicity, or a lack of emotional complexity.
Conclusion
Spooling in printing is a technical process that ensures the efficient handling of print jobs, but it also serves as a fascinating metaphor for the way our minds process and organize the complex data of our dreams. By understanding the mechanics of spooling, we can gain insights into the subconscious processes that shape our dream experiences and the emotional “colors” that define them.
Related Q&A
Q: Can spooling be used for devices other than printers? A: Yes, spooling can be used for any peripheral device that requires data to be processed at a different rate than the computer can provide. This includes plotters, fax machines, and even some types of storage devices.
Q: How does spooling affect the speed of printing? A: Spooling can actually improve the speed of printing by allowing the computer to send data to the printer at a faster rate than the printer can process it. The spooler then manages the flow of data, ensuring that the printer is not overwhelmed and can process the data at its own pace.
Q: What happens if the spooler encounters an error? A: If the spooler encounters an error, such as a paper jam or a printer malfunction, it can pause the print job and notify the user. Once the issue is resolved, the spooler can resume the print job from where it left off.
Q: Can the color of dreams be influenced by external factors? A: Yes, the color of dreams can be influenced by various external factors, such as the environment, stress levels, and even the foods we eat. For example, a stressful day might result in dreams with darker, more intense colors, while a relaxing environment might lead to dreams with lighter, more soothing colors.
Q: Is there a way to control the color of your dreams? A: While it’s difficult to directly control the color of your dreams, certain practices such as meditation, visualization, and keeping a dream journal can help you become more aware of your dreams and potentially influence their content and emotional tone.